Question
Locus of a moving point is ______ if it moves such that it keeps a fixed distance from a fixed point.
Options
Circle
Line
Angle
Line segment

Solution
Locus of a moving point is circle if it moves such that it keeps a fixed distance from a fixed point.
Explanation:
The locus is the set of all positions of the moving point. If the point always remains at a fixed distance from a fixed point, all such positions form a circle with the fixed point as centre and the fixed distance as the radius.
